Hot Coffee For a Healthy Baby Girl
Pregnancy brings with it plenty of sacrifices, from giving up delicious Brie to forgoing your morning latte altogether. Does that mean your pregnancy means forgoing this morning treat as well?
While pregnant, you can still enjoy hot coffee – just opt for decaf! A cup of brewed decaf contains 2-5mg of caffeine – much lower than the most widely accepted daily limit for safe caffeine intake during gestation.
Not forgetting, caffeine can also be found in tea, ice cream and chocolate! For maximum safety, stick with smaller sizes such as one shot of espresso at most when ordering coffee – alternatively try switching to herbal brews that are pregnancy-safe!
